The expression showing the prime factorization of 48 is 2×2×2×2×3, making the second option the right choice.

A prime number is any number that is divisible by only two numbers, and the two numbers are 1 and itself.

The prime factorization of any number is the number written as the product of only prime numbers.

In the question, we are asked to identify the expression, that shows the prime factorization of 48.

  • 2×2×3: Solving this, we get 12, implying that 2×2×3 is the prime factorization of 12 and not 48.
  • 2×2×2×2×3: Solving this, we get 48, implying that 2×2×2×2×3 is the prime factorization of 48.
  • 2×2×2× 3: Solving this, we get 24, implying that 2×2×2× 3 is the prime factorization of 24 and not 48.
  • 2×2×2×3×3: Solving this, we get 72, implying that 2×2×2×3×3 is the prime factorization of 72 and not 48.


Thus, the expression showing the prime factorization of 48 is 2×2×2×2×3, making the second option the right choice.
